how do i single-click a desktop icon to run the application? i'm using
windows xp home edition
Ken Blake, MVP - 31 Mar 2006 19:01 GMT
> how do i single-click a desktop icon to run the application? i'm using
> windows xp home edition

In My Computer, go to Tools | Folder Options, and change to that setting on
the General tab.
